The top local stories this morning from KERA News:

Thousands took to the streets across Texas and the country to demonstrate solidarity in the second Women’s March.

The March for Life also took place Saturday, which drew anti-abortion supporters. Those in attendance said they also cared about issues represented in the Women’s March.
